Off-road clearance: new all-terrain vehicles will be presented at the Army-2024 forum
Plastun family vehicles are designed to transport cargo, wounded and personnel
Two new all-terrain vehicles - the tracked Plastun—2 and the wheeled tactical transporter Plastun-TT - will be presented at the Army 2024 International Military Technical Forum, which opens on Monday, August 12. Both vehicles are designed to transport cargo, wounded and personnel both on ordinary roads and off-road. Experts note that both vehicles are needed by the army as front-line supply vehicles, and they will be in particular demand during off-road periods.
With a light hand: how did the new Kalashnikov light machine gun turn out?
The Kalashnikov Concern has produced the first batch of RPL-20 machine guns for delivery to the troops. The new weapon is characterized by relative lightness and compactness and is designed for fire support of assault units, effective firing from unstable positions, for example in a confined space, in mountainous and wooded areas. The participants of his tests in the troops noted the high accuracy and intensity of the fire. The machine gun will be a great help to the troops and will be in demand during assault operations, experts say.

"Can opener" for a Western tank: the capabilities of Russian combat modules
A combat module is a complete (often replaceable) element of military equipment that carries weapons, optoelectronic devices, and auxiliary equipment. If crew members are located in it, it is called a combat compartment. The Berezhok, shown in the story of the Zvezda TV channel, is an example of a combat compartment, since it houses the workplaces of the commander and the gunner.
